Chapter 181: Drawing Out Taiyin Cold Qi

The moment the Lunar Cold Energy invaded his body, Jiang Changkong seized the opportunity, and the Taiyin Sword once again rose like a hazy moon.

Moonlight cascaded, as if he were the Moon Goddess herself, commanding Taiyin—mesmerizing and awe-inspiring.

The middle-aged man’s expression shifted. Switching his longsword to his left hand, he unleashed a torrent of Star Power from within.

A deafening explosion erupted, shattering the silvery ice on the ground. A terrifying shockwave swept in all directions, dust mingling with moonlight as it scattered everywhere.

Jiang Changkong’s gaze sharpened. He retreated violently, his face turning exceptionally grim.

In contrast, the middle-aged man’s expression was equally unpleasant as he staggered back over ten meters.

Hum

Silently and without warning, the Taiyin Blade abruptly appeared.

The middle-aged man’s face changed again. With Star Power surging, a vial of potion materialized in his right hand.

Without hesitation, he downed the potion in one gulp.

Rumble

Vast fluctuations of Star Power shook the earth, cracking it open with deep fissures.

Soil flew into the air, the cold pond trembled, and water surged skyward.

The Taiyin Blade, before it could even get close, was directly swept away by this surge of Star Power.

“This power… he’s taken a drug.”

“Jiang Changyue is truly formidable, actually pushing him into a crisis.”

“This guy really has no shame. At the late Star Spirit stage, he resorts to drugs?”

Hidden in the shadows, a group of people watched the scene in shock, simultaneously retreating far away to avoid being caught in the crossfire.

“It ends here.”

The middle-aged man’s expression turned sinister, his eyes filled with killing intent. “You’re the first mid-stage Star Spirit to force me to use a potion!”

“Indeed, it ends here.”

Jiang Changkong beckoned, and the Taiyin Blade flew back, aligning itself with the Taiyin Sword before him.

The Moon Laurel Leaves swayed, moonlight ebbing and flowing like two crescent moons.

“Ocean-Sundering Sword!”

The middle-aged man roared, gathering immense Star Power and channeling it all into his azure longsword.

The sound of crashing waves echoed as a vast ocean transformed into sword light.

It was like an infinite sword, its sword energy boundless and inexhaustible.

Beneath his black robes, Jiang Changkong’s expression turned icy. Extending both hands, he lightly tapped the two Moon Laurel Leaves. “Moonlight Essence.”

With a soft utterance, the Moon Laurel Leaves trembled, unleashing a torrent of Lunar Cold Energy.

Then, responding to the resonance, the Taiyin Sword trembled violently, and an unprecedented surge of sword energy rose from it.

A sword intent capable of annihilating everything boiled over. Centered on the sword tip, the ground froze over once more.

As the Moon Laurel Leaves made contact, the cold energy within was drawn forth. The first to bear the brunt was none other than Jiang Changkong himself.

In an instant, Jiang Changkong transformed into an ice sculpture.

“What is this…?”

The middle-aged man’s face contorted wildly. Without even time to unleash his sword light, he surged with Star Power from within, desperate to escape.

But the cold energy was too terrifying, spreading too quickly, and the power at the sword tip was even more horrifying.

The annihilating sword energy filled a radius of hundreds of meters, omnipresent and inescapable.

Thud

His barely shifted foot was instantly pierced. Moonforce rapidly spread throughout his body, transforming him into an ice sculpture.

The colossal sword light trembled, yet before it could strike down, a silvery-white moonlight flashed, morphing into a massive silver-white sword.

Even the sword light was frozen!

“What kind of power is this? Even a Star Spirit Peak expert couldn’t withstand it, could they?”

In the distance, figures fled in terror.

Because the Lunar Cold Energy continued to spread, instantly filling a radius of hundreds of meters. It showed no signs of stopping, still expanding in all directions.

“Is he insane? Unleashing such power—even Jiang Changyue won’t survive this.”

Among those hidden in the shadows, some failed to escape in time and had already turned into ice sculptures, frozen in place.

As for the middle-aged man, his fate was even more tragic. Under the sword energy, his body was riddled with cracks.

Within the ice sculpture lay the corpse covered in sword marks, its life force long extinguished.

The Moon Laurel Leaf trembled faintly, while the Lunar Blade and Sword continued to quiver.

Silver-white power surged in all directions, its reach unknown. Looking around, the world was awash in nothing but silver-white light.

After half a minute of continuous release, the Moon Laurel Leaf ceased its trembling, and the blade and sword returned to stillness, standing upright in place.

Jiang Changkong, now encased in ice, was not dead. The Taiyin Star Power within his body was rapidly circulating.

The ice covering his body transformed into strands of pure energy, replenishing his expended Star Power.

If there was any discomfort, it was simply the intense cold. He might suffer frostbite afterward.

After waiting for half an hour, the Moonforce on his body finally dissipated. Jiang Changkong spat out a mouthful of ice shards.

Indeed, he had intended to exhale a sigh of relief, but what came out was ice.

The Moon Laurel Leaf dimmed slightly, and the Lunar Blade and Sword also lost their luster. The sword tip no longer emitted the slightest hint of cold.

Glancing at the Taiyin Cold Pool behind him, although the freezing power had some effect, it likely couldn’t completely seal the pool.

The pool was filled with Taiyin Star Power, and beneath it lay the Taiyin Lake. Freezing it was nearly impossible.

Jiang Changkong melted the ice covering the pool and descended into the cold waters, heading straight for the Taiyin Lake.

The earlier sword energy had been blocked by him, so this area remained unaffected.

The Star Demons were still hidden deep within. Jiang Changkong carefully placed the Lunar Blade and Sword back into the pool to absorb the Taiyin Star Power once more.

The Taiyin Star Power contained here was terrifying. If unleashed, even a Star Spirit Peak expert would likely fall here.

If he could control this power, wouldn’t he be able to defeat anyone instantly, as long as no High-Rank Martial Artist appeared?

He made no commotion, avoiding alerting the Star Demons. After absorbing the Taiyin Star Power, he left immediately.

Returning outside the cold pool, Jiang Changkong examined the middle-aged man’s body, his attention drawn to the ring on the man’s finger and the jade pendant at his waist.

He melted the Taiyin Star Power, and the finger wearing the ring fell off.

“Could it be shattered?” Jiang Changkong then melted the ice sealing the jade pendant. The pendant, along with a fragment of clothing, dropped to the ground.

It was truly shattered!

If this corpse were thawed, it would likely turn into a pile of minced flesh.

Jiang Changkong took the two items and infused them with Star Power. Both were Spatial Equipment!

He reassembled the severed finger and the clothing fragment, refroze them, and then departed.

Instead of heading to the research institute’s outpost, he chose a random direction and left. He was in poor condition himself, nearly critically injured.

If he were to face such an ordeal again now, even as a Taiyin Star Power cultivator, he would not survive.

This was only because he was a Taiyin Star Power cultivator and the wielder of the Lunar Blade and Sword, which spared him from the sword energy’s attack.

“If the complete Lunar Sword were to unleash its power, could an ordinary High-Rank Martial Artist withstand it?”

The thought crossed Jiang Changkong’s mind, but it remained just that—a thought.

He had never seen a High-Rank Martial Artist, and fully restoring the Lunar Sword was nearly impossible.

“Still, this guy had quite a few Star Stones.”

Jiang Changkong inspected the items. The ring contained potions, while the jade pendant held Star Stones.

One thousand Fifth Rank High-Grade stones, five hundred Fifth Rank Top-Grade stones.

There were also three thousand Fifth Rank Mid-Grade stones, but no Fifth Rank Low-Grade ones.

A few of the potions also contained Essence, though not in significant amounts.

1.1 million units of Essence!

“This guy must have thoroughly looted all three families.”

Jiang Changkong murmured to himself. These people were not so benevolent as to help the three families for free.

With everyone gathering Star Stones, they certainly wouldn’t have spared these three families.

“In that case, I now have over 1.6 million Essence. Should I wipe out the three families now?”

Jiang Changkong pondered. The three families might have run out of Star Stones, but what if they still had hidden cards up their sleeves?

He decided to heal his injuries first. As for the remaining Essence, he could easily obtain it by saving a few people.

In this world, there were plenty of people who refused to listen to reason and seemed determined to seek death. Moreover, the abyss was fraught with dangers.

Saving their lives and asking for some Star Stones in return wasn’t too much to ask.
